- The article offers information on the contribution of Leone Burton to the field of mathematics in Great Britain and worldwide. She was appointed Professor of Science and Mathematics Education at the University of Birmingham in England where she managed a legion of doctoral students. She has collaborated with Ann Floyd, Nick James and John Mason of the Open University in developing a mathematics course for teachers named Developing Mathematical Thinking. Burton served as convenor for the International Organization of Women and Mathematics Education (IOWME).
